How much do assistant inspector j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for assistant inspector in Ohio is $16.63,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.18 and $18.24 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the work of assistant inspector?

An assistant inspector supports inspectors by conducting inspections, ensuring compliance with regulations, and documenting findings. They often review safety standards, operate inspection tools, and may assist in preparing reports or reports for regulatory agencies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assistant inspector?

To thrive as an Assistant Inspector, you need strong attention to detail, analytical abilities, and a relevant diploma or degree, often in engineering, construction, or a related field. Familiarity with inspection tools, safety regulations, and reporting software is typically required, along with any necessary certifications such as OSHA or industry-specific credentials. Excellent communication, integrity, and problem-solving skills help you work effectively with teams and ensure compliance. These skills are important to ensure accurate inspections, uphold safety standards, and maintain regulatory compliance in various environments.

The main difference between an Assistant Inspector and an Inspector lies in their responsibilities and level of authority. Assistant Inspectors support and assist Inspectors in conducting inspections, often handling preliminary tasks. Inspectors perform detailed evaluations and make final decisions. Both roles require similar credentials, but Inspectors usually have more experience and authority in the inspection process.

What is an assistant inspector?

An assistant inspector is a professional who supports senior inspectors in examining and evaluating compliance with regulations, safety standards, or quality controls within various industries such as construction, manufacturing, or public safety. They often assist with inspections, document findings, and may require relevant certifications or training to perform their duties effectively.

What are some typical challenges faced by an assistant inspector, and how can they be addressed?

Assistant Inspectors often encounter challenges such as managing a high volume of inspection tasks while ensuring accuracy and compliance with regulations. Balancing fieldwork with detailed report writing and documentation can also be demanding. These challenges can be addressed by staying organized, prioritizing workload, and maintaining effective communication with supervisors and team members. Gaining familiarity with industry standards and utilizing digital tools for record-keeping can further improve efficiency and accuracy.
